@ashutoshbajad50847 ай бұрын
Hi, there are 3 tax benefits in NPS which a Corporate Subscriber can get. Who is a corporate subscriber? Answer is a nps subscriber who shift or join NPS to their company/corporate account so that 10% od their basic salary is invested to nps account on monthly basis. 3 tax benefits are - a) u/s 80 C - Limit is 1.5 lacs, mostly it gets fulfilled with employee pf, insurance etc. b) u/s 80 C 1 B - this sec is exclusively for nps, limit is 50k. Now both 80c & 80c1b are for individual contribution, it means contribution towards NPS account from your own bank account. c) u/s 80 C 2D - here in this sec your contribution of 10% of (basic+DA) salary through your employer is tax exempted. Limit for this is 7.5 lacs which includes employer PF, employer NPS & superannuation fund. Corporate subscriber can get benefits of all 3 tax benefits in old tax regime.
